  CORNING SUNSENSORS™ PLASTIC PHOTOCHROMIC LENSES
 

 

 

Top 10 Reasons to Dispense Corning SunSensors™ Plastic Photochromic Lenses.

1. DARKER. 20% darker outdoors than ordinary plastic photochromics, with excellent all-weather performance.

2. FASTER. Sunglass dark in one minute, yet they become 17% clearer indoors in the first five minutes when compared to ordinary plastic photochromics.

3. THINNER. Lenses can be processed to a thinner* center, providing a thin, attractive lens profile.

4 LIGHTER. Patented lens material is lighter weight than polycarbonate, providing greater patent comfort.

5. DURABLE. Photochromic molecules are throughout the lens material, resulting in a durable, consistent and longer lasting lens.

6. RELIABLE. Patented technology consistently darkens and fades with a cosmetically pleasing color. Also available in warm brown.

7. CHOICE. SunSensors™ lenses are available in finished single vision, bifocals trifocals and progressives.

8. VALUE. Corning's world-class engineering has produced a high-quality product with a lower manufacturing cost. The key benefit is an excellent value for both you and your patients.

9. BRAND RECOGNITION. Patients have confidence in the highly recognized and trusted Corning brand name.

10. AND MORE... A/R compatibility, natural UV absorption and built-in scratch resistance.

Compared to current leading plastic photochromic in both gray and brown.
Solar simulator test temperature 72 degrees Fahrenheit, 2.0mm center. Dark lenses simulated at two minutes at 72 degrees Fahrenheit.
*Individual manufacturer recommendations may vary.
